Publication number: 20260040893Abstract: A method of inspecting a wafer dicing process entails performing a scanning process on a grooved wafer with a light beam used by an optical scanning device. The method includes using a film layer of the grooved wafer as an incident surface for the scanning process; performing the scanning process on the grooved wafer in a Y-axis direction to obtain XZ section structure images corresponding in position to consecutive different Y-axis positions on the grooved wafer; analyzing the XZ section structure images at the consecutive different positions and defining positions corresponding in position to grooves, the film layer, a silicon layer and a metal layer; and analyzing a depth of each of the grooves to determine whether the grooved wafer is grooved successfully or grooved unsuccessfully. Therefore, the method is applicable to wafer processing procedures and addresses the lack of inspection methods in the wafer dicing process.Type: ApplicationFiled: October 7, 2024Publication date: February 5, 2026Applicant: OPXION TECHNOLOGY INC.Inventors: FENG-YU CHANG, MENG-TSAN TSAI, WEN-JU CHEN, MING-FENG WU, PO-HSU SU, CHENG-YU LU

Publication number: 20250362239Abstract: An optical scanning system for non-destructively acquiring a three-dimensional structure of an object includes an optical image processing device and an optical scanning device. The optical image processing device is configured to generate an optical beam along a first optical axis direction. The optical scanning device is configured to convert the optical beam along the first optical axis direction into an optical beam along a second optical axis direction, and scan an object to be inspected by using the optical beam along the second optical axis direction. The optical image processing device scans the object to be inspected by the optical scanning device along X-axis and Y-axis directions to acquire YZ and XZ cross section structural images at different consecutive positions, so as to reconstruct a three-dimensional structural image.Type: ApplicationFiled: July 5, 2024Publication date: November 27, 2025Applicant: OPXION TECHNOLOGY INC.Inventors: FENG-YU CHANG, WEN-JU CHEN, MING-FENG WU, PO-HSU SU, CHENG-YU LU, MENG-TSAN TSAI

Patent number: 10589940Abstract: A power wheel including a positioning device, a wireless communication module, and a controller is provided, where the controller is configured to operate in an active mode or a passive mode. When operating in the passive mode, the controller is configured to: acquire route information and moving information from the power wheel operating in the active mode by the wireless communication module, and acquire relative position information with the other power wheels by the positioning device; and determine a rotation strategy of the power wheel according to the route information, the moving information and the relative position information. When operating in the active mode, the controller is configured to: acquire the route information, and transmit the route information to the other power wheels; and determine the rotation strategy of the power wheel according to the route information. In addition, a cooperative carrying method of the power wheel is also provided.Type: GrantFiled: December 5, 2017Date of Patent: March 17, 2020Assignee: Metal Industries Research & Development CentreInventors: Kuang-Shine Yang, Ping-Hua Su, Cheng-Yu Lu, Chiu-Feng Lin, Ying-Cherng Lu, Pao-Hsien Hsieh, Chia-Lung Huang

Patent number: 8850248Abstract: A multi-core electronic system for accessing a data storage device includes a plurality of processors, a data transmission interface and a rate adjustment module. The processors respectively provide a bandwidth requirement, and communicate with the data storage device via the shared data transmission interface. The rate adjustment module receives the bandwidth requirements, and determines a transmission rate of the data transmission interface according to the bandwidth requirements.Type: GrantFiled: July 26, 2011Date of Patent: September 30, 2014Assignee: MStar Semiconductor, Inc.Inventors: Ping-Cheng Hou, Cheng-Yu Lu, Chieh-Wen Shih, Jen-Shi Wu, Chung-Ching Chen

Patent number: 8497853Abstract: A flat panel display device, LCD controller and associated method is provided. The flat panel display device includes a display panel, a lamp for providing a backlight source for the display panel, a power transformation module for providing a power source for the lamp, a non-volatile storage unit for storing program code, and a display controller. The display controller includes an image processing module for processing image data and outputting processed results to the display panel, and a digital pulse width modulation module for adjusting on and off time of the power transformation module with reference to a synchronization signal.Type: GrantFiled: June 22, 2006Date of Patent: July 30, 2013Assignee: MStar Semiconductor, Inc.Inventors: Sterling Smith, Chih-Tien Chang, Kuo-Feng Hsu, Cheng-Yu Lu, Song-Yi Lin, Guo-Kiang Hung

Publication number: 20080290175Abstract: A layer-built body having hidden barcodes and figures thereof is disclosed in the invention, so as to allow barcode scanning devices to read the barcodes, the layer-built body comprising: a lenticular lens sheet divided into a first surface and a second surface, and the first surface has a plurality of convex lens-shaped optical structures disposed thereon; a patterned layer printed with trademarks or figures, and divided into a plurality of striped images; and at least a barcode layer printed with information about barcodes and divided into a plurality of striped images.Type: ApplicationFiled: March 24, 2008Publication date: November 27, 2008Applicants: Alfred Lean-Foo CHEN, Shuo-Fang LIU, Chen-Yuan KAOInventors: Alfred Lean-Foo Chen, Shuo-Fang Liu, Yuei-An Liou, Hsin-His Lai, Meng-Hsuan Lee, Ying-Hsiu Chen, Chen-Yuan Kao, Chang-Ching Chien, Jung-Hao Chi, Cheng-Yu Lu

Patent number: 6925614Abstract: System and method for integrated circuit (IC) design using silicon intellectual property (IP) libraries that permits the protecting of the designs of circuits in the silicon IP while allowing correctness verification of the IC design. A preferred embodiment comprises a phantom cell (for example, phantom cell 505) that contains circuit elements (for example, circuit element EL-A 510) connected to each input/output pin of the phantom cell. The inclusion of the circuit elements permits an engineering design tool to check for improperly connected wiring.Type: GrantFiled: April 1, 2003Date of Patent: August 2, 2005Assignee: Taiwan Semiconductor Manufacturing Company, Ltd.Inventors: Cheng-Yu Lu, Jun-Jyeh Hsiao, Louis Liu
